Benching Puig against a righty with reasonably pronounced platoon splits for his career is one thing. Still a bit odd to rest your best player, but I can at least understand the reasoning to get Ethier, a notorious platoon hitter, Crawford (another lefty) and Kemp (really hot down the stretch) in there.
But using your best hitter to pinch run instead of pinch hit in the highest leverage at-bats of the game and, for that matter, the season? So that Justin Turner, Dee Gordon and Carl Crawford can hit in those scenarios? Against a guy with reverse splits at that?
That one you'll have to explain to me.

Actually of all the decisions Mattingly made this game, this one is far from the worst. AJ Ellis is our slowest runner (except maybe AGon), and Justin Turner has been far and away the best pinch hitter this season. Puig has the most speed off the bench, so there wasn't really anyone else to put in besides him.
